Kings Lynn Train Station ensures that your ticket needs are well cared for with a ticket office open through the week from early morning till late evening. Additionally, ticket machines operate around the clock and support accessible features, including discounts through the Disabled Persons Railcard. While the station features step-free access throughout its premises, it does not offer accessible toilets or waiting rooms, so plan accordingly. However, you can rest easy knowing you can collect tickets purchased online right from the station.
The station prides itself on being Category-A, with step-free access available to all platforms. A dedicated staff-operated ramp is accessible for those needing assistance between the train and station levels. Although waiting rooms are absent, a comfortable seating area is provided. Travelers can reach out to the station's staff for unbooked assistance by arriving 20 minutes before departure, ensuring they have enough time to arrange support at your destination or connecting station.
When you're ready to explore beyond Kings Lynn, the station offers numerous options for onward travel. There are taxis readily available right outside the station. For those taking the bus, planning onward journeys is facilitated by available information at the station. While there are no cycle hire services, bicycles can be safely stored at the station entrance with CCTV-covered sheltered racks ensuring your ride stays secure.
